What do shooting emoji mean?

The shooting star emoji 🌠 generally represents wishes, hope, sudden inspiration, or a magical moment worth remembering. It’s often paired with dreamy or romantic messages, celebrations of good news, or comments about something rare and exciting happening. Context always shapes the exact meaning.

Here’s a closer look at the core emojis people use alongside it.

🌠 Shooting Star is the anchor emoji. It usually signals a wish, a hope, or something amazing that just happened out of nowhere.

✨ Sparkles add shine to anything. On its own it means something feels special, magical, or exciting.

🌟 Glowing Star points to achievement or pride. It’s the “you did something great” star.

💫 Dizzy Symbol suggests a swirl of energy or a slightly dazed, dreamy feeling, like being starstruck.

⭐ Star is the simplest version, often used for ratings, favorites, or general approval.

🌙 Crescent Moon brings in the nighttime mood, pairing naturally with stars for late-night or cozy conversations.

Misreadings happen when people assume every star emoji is romantic. Sometimes it’s just celebrating a small win or setting a nighttime scene, so tone and surrounding words matter more than the emoji alone.

How to use shooting emoji the right way

WhatsApp

WhatsApp conversations tend to be personal, so shooting star emojis fit well in messages about hopes, wishes, or reflecting on your day. A simple 🌠 next to “hope tomorrow goes well” reads warm without being over the top.

Instagram

On Instagram, these emojis shine in captions about milestones, night photography, or aesthetic moments. Comments like “this shot is 🌟✨” work naturally under a friend’s photo or a scenic post.

TikTok

TikTok comments lean more playful. People use 💫 or 🌌 to react to something surreal, funny, or unexpectedly good, often stacked with other reactions for emphasis.

Why do emojis look different on iPhone vs Android?

Each operating system designs its own emoji artwork while following the same Unicode standard. That’s why 🌠 might look slightly different depending on the device.
